University (Birmingham) Station is equipped with a host of conveniences designed to facilitate smooth travel. The ticket office operates from 07:00 to 20:00 on weekdays, slightly shorter on weekends, ensuring ample opportunity to purchase tickets. For added convenience, there are ticket machines available that can also handle ticket collections for purchases made online. If you need any assistance, station staff is on hand during the ticket office hours, and customer help points are strategically placed to assist you further.
Accessibility is a top priority, with step-free access to all platforms, accessible ticket machines, and ramp access for trains. While luggage storage isn't available, there's ample seating and waiting areas for those looking to relax before departure. Plus, national key toilets ensure that facilities are accessible for all, with staff on hand to provide RADAR keys if needed.
Transporting you to your next destination is seamless with well-coordinated rail replacement services departing from nearby bus stops on New Fosse Way. For more personalized travel, taxicab companies like UNI Station BBs and TOA operate locally, providing an easy transfer from the station to any nearby location. If buses are your preferred mode of onward travel, the station provides printable information to plan your journey effortlessly.

Headbolt Lane station is equipped with a comprehensive range of facilities to make your travel experience smooth and efficient. The ticket office is open from as early as 05:33 until midnight, ensuring you have ample opportunity to purchase and collect tickets at your convenience. For added ease, ticket machines are also accessible, including those designed for disability access.
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access available throughout the station. Those with reduced mobility will find accessible ticket machines, ramps for train access, and accessible toilets. Helpful staff are available from early morning to late night to assist you every step of the way. And for your peace of mind, the station is monitored by CCTV.
Seamlessly linked to the Merseyrail network, Headbolt Lane station serves as a convenient hub for onward journeys. If you're planning to head to Liverpool John Lennon Airport, you can easily book a combined train and bus ticket right at the station. Local buses also connect you to various routes, ensuring you have plenty of options to reach your final destination.
